谷歌云数据存储的云存储服务性能优化实践案例与策略分析
在当今信息化时代,云计算已经成为各行各业不可或缺的技术基础设施,而云存储作为云计算的核心组成部分,其性能优化显得尤为重要。谷歌云(Google Cloud)提供的云存储服务,以其高可用性、高可靠性和全球化分布的特点,广泛应用于各类企业和开发者中。本文将深入分析谷歌云云存储服务的优势,结合实际案例,探讨如何通过性能优化策略提升云存储的效率和响应速度。
一、谷歌云存储服务的优势
谷歌云提供了多种云存储解决方案,包括但不限于Google Cloud Storage(GCS)、Persistent Disks、Cloud Filestore等。每一种存储方式都有其独特的优势,使其能够满足不同类型企业的需求。
- 全球分布的网络:谷歌云的数据中心遍布全球,能够提供跨区域、低延迟的存储服务。通过智能化路由,用户可以将数据存储在离其业务运营最近的地点,从而显著提高数据访问速度。
- 高可扩展性:谷歌云的存储解决方案能够根据需求快速扩展,支持从小型存储到PB级别的数据量。无论是开发测试阶段的小规模应用,还是需要处理大数据的企业级应用,谷歌云都能够提供灵活的资源配备。
- 强大的安全性:谷歌云通过多层加密、安全防火墙、身份认证机制等手段,保障数据在存储和传输过程中的安全性。此外,Google Cloud还符合多个行业标准和合规要求,如GDPR、HIPAA等。
- 高性能存储:谷歌云采用了业界领先的硬件设施和网络架构,尤其是在数据存储的读写性能方面,能够提供快速、稳定的访问体验。
二、谷歌云存储服务的性能优化策略
虽然谷歌云提供了高效、稳定的存储解决方案,但根据不同的业务需求和场景,合理优化云存储的性能可以进一步提升数据的访问速度和存储效率。以下是几项关键的性能优化策略:
1. 选择合适的存储类型
谷歌云提供了不同类型的存储服务,如标准存储、近线存储、冷存储等。每种存储类型都有其适用的场景。例如,Google Cloud Storage(GCS)标准存储适合频繁访问的数据,而冷存储则适合长期存储不常访问的数据。
根据数据的访问频率、存储时长以及成本考虑,选择合适的存储类型,不仅能保证存储效率,还能降低成本。例如,针对备份和归档数据,选择Google Cloud Nearline和Coldline存储可以大幅度节省存储成本,同时确保数据安全性和可靠性。
2. 数据分布优化
谷歌云的数据存储系统具有全球分布性,能够通过智能的负载均衡机制,将用户请求路由到离用户最近的存储节点。为了进一步提升存储服务的性能,企业应合理设计数据分布策略。
例如,用户可以通过将热点数据分布在多个地区的数据中心,从而实现负载均衡,避免某一节点的拥堵影响整体访问速度。同时,使用Multi-Regional Storage来存储需要高可用性的应用数据,能够确保即使某一地区发生故障,数据仍然能够快速恢复。
3. 利用缓存技术
在需要频繁读取数据的场景下,利用缓存技术可以显著提升性能。谷歌云提供了Cloud CDN和Memorystore等缓存服务,可以在用户请求数据之前将数据缓存到边缘节点或内存中,从而减少数据访问延迟。
例如,对于电商网站或内容交付服务(CDN)等需要频繁读取静态资源的应用,通过Cloud CDN缓存热点数据,可以大幅度提高响应速度,降低存储访问的延迟。
4. 合理的存储访问策略
为了提升存储性能,企业需要制定合理的存储访问策略,避免过多的无效请求和不必要的数据访问。
- 批量处理:尽量通过批量上传或下载的方式减少频繁的小数据请求,从而降低系统的负载。
- 延迟加载:对于非关键数据,可以采用延迟加载的方式,避免一次性加载大量数据,提升存储性能。
5. 使用多线程和并行处理
对于大规模的数据迁移和处理,使用多线程或并行处理技术可以显著提升效率。谷歌云提供的Transfer Appliance和Cloud Dataflow等服务,支持高效的数据传输和处理,可以在云端快速处理大数据集。
例如,在进行数据迁移时,用户可以将数据分成多个小块,通过多线程并行上传,极大地提高上传速度和处理效率。
三、实践案例:性能优化提升存储效率
以下是一个关于利用谷歌云优化云存储性能的实际案例:
某全球电商平台面临着海量商品数据和用户数据存储的挑战。在将数据迁移到谷歌云之后,他们通过以下策略显著提升了存储性能:
- 根据数据访问频率将不同类型的存储数据分配到Google Cloud Nearline和Coldline存储中,大幅度降低了存储成本。
- 使用Multi-Regional Storage将高频访问的数据存储在多个区域,减少了用户访问延迟。
- 采用Cloud CDN缓存静态资源,提高了电商平台页面加载速度,提升了用户体验。
- 通过批量上传和多线程处理加速了商品数据的迁移过程,减少了停机时间。
通过这些优化策略,电商平台不仅提升了存储访问速度,还节省了大量的存储成本,确保了业务的高效运作。

四、结语
谷歌云提供了高效、安全、可扩展的云存储解决方案,适用于各种规模和类型的业务。通过合理的存储类型选择、数据分布优化、缓存技术应用以及存储访问策略的调整,企业可以显著提升云存储的性能,确保数据访问的快速性和高效性。在云计算日益发展的背景下,掌握这些云存储优化策略,不仅能够提高企业的运营效率,还能降低整体成本。

评论列表 (0条):
加载更多评论 Loading...